In 1508, despite strong advice to the contrary, the powerful Pope Julius II commissioned Michelangelo to paint the ceiling of the newly restored Sistine Chapel. With little experience as a painter (though famed for his sculpture David ), Michelangelo was reluctant to begin the massive project.

WebIt was Pope Julius II who chose Michelangelo Buonarroti to decorate the ceiling of the Sistine Chapel.Michelangelo completed the ceiling and vault decoration in just 4 years. Initially, he was only supposed to paint the figures of the 12 Apostles, but by the end of the work more than 300 figures had been painted by the artist.. Works on the Sistine Chapel

To do the thing, Michelangelo builds a scaffold of his own… lithonia lrp-2The Tomb of Pope Julius II is a sculptural and architectural ensemble by Michelangelo and his assistants, originally commissioned in 1505 but not completed until 1545 on a much reduced scale. Originally intended for St. Peter's Basilica, the structure was instead placed in the church of San Pietro in Vincoli on the Esquiline in Rome after the pope's death.
